At 5:00 p.m., commuting pressure is building. Roads and platforms can be crowded as schools, offices, and shops change shifts. In the wet season, rain near rush hour may bring slower traffic and local flooding. Anyone catching a ferry or provincial bus should rely on the operator's stated check-in time.
For flights and sea travel, use the departure terminal's local date and follow the carrier's check-in deadline rather than treating departure time as arrival time.
School and office calendars may change around national holidays, local fiestas, elections, class suspensions, and emergency declarations.
A posted opening hour does not guarantee immediate service when queues, branch cut-offs, security checks, or limited appointment slots apply.
The country uses local standard time, UTC+8, throughout the year and does not change clocks for daylight saving time.
